JOB DESCRIPTION
· Assess the client’s living environment, determine the individual’s strengths, weaknesses and needs, as well as determine the
strengths and needs of the recipient’s natural support system. Assess the ongoing changes and/or needs and address them.
· Develop a comprehensive services plan in a team approach, which is individualized and contains specific measurable and behavioral
objectives and problems to address the client’s needs. Assist in the treatment team planning and review of the services plan.
· Link the client or family to the community resources. Coordinate and integrate the services provided to the client.
· Monitor the client’s plan of care that includes advocating for the client's needs: Department of Children and Families, and other agencies or organizations.
JOB REQUIREMENTS
· Has documentation of a minimum of a baccalaureate degree from an accredited university, with major course work in the areas of
psychology, social work, health education or a related human services field and has a minimum of one year of full time or equivalent
experience working with clients with special needs.
· Has completed AHCA approved case management training (attach Case Manager Training Certificate) and will complete periodic
retraining, as required by the district.
· Knowledge of all available resources in the service area for client with mental illness.
· Knowledgeable of and will comply with state and federal statutes, rules and policies that effect the target population.
